How to connect PostgreSQL and Squarespace
Integrating PostgreSQL with Squarespace opens up a world of possibilities for managing your data seamlessly. By utilizing no-code platforms like Latenode, you can effortlessly automate data transfers between your database and your website, ensuring that your content is always up-to-date. This connection allows you to harness the power of PostgreSQL’s robust data management while taking advantage of Squarespace's user-friendly design capabilities. With the right tools, your workflow becomes more efficient, making it easier to focus on growing your online presence.
Step 1: Create a New Scenario to Connect PostgreSQL and Squarespace
Step 2: Add the First Step
Step 3: Add the PostgreSQL Node
Step 4: Configure the PostgreSQL
Step 5: Add the Squarespace Node
Step 6: Authenticate Squarespace
Step 7: Configure the PostgreSQL and Squarespace Nodes
Step 8: Set Up the PostgreSQL and Squarespace Integration
Step 9: Save and Activate the Scenario
Step 10: Test the Scenario
Why Integrate PostgreSQL and Squarespace?
PostgreSQL and Squarespace are two powerful tools that can significantly enhance your web development process, even when used separately. However, when integrated correctly, they can provide an even more dynamic and personalized experience for users.
PostgreSQL is an advanced relational database management system known for its reliability, flexibility, and strong support for various data types. It is highly effective for managing complex datasets and provides robust features such as:
- ACID compliance for transaction reliability
- Extensibility with custom functions and data types
- Advanced security features for data protection
- Support for geographic objects with PostGIS extension
Squarespace, on the other hand, is a popular website builder that allows users to create visually stunning websites without the need for coding expertise. It provides a user-friendly interface with various templates and hosting solutions. Squarespace is particularly beneficial for:
- Easy design customization
- Integrated e-commerce solutions
- Built-in SEO tools
- Responsive design for mobile devices
While Squarespace offers many built-in functionalities, there are scenarios where users may need to leverage PostgreSQL's advanced capabilities for data management. This is where integration becomes essential. Using an integration platform like Latenode, users can:
- Connect Squarespace to PostgreSQL seamlessly.
- Automate data transfers, such as customer information and order details.
- Perform complex queries and analytics directly from the database.
- Enhance the website’s functionality by utilizing extensive data sets.
Through the use of Latenode, users can create sophisticated workflows that combine the aesthetic and functional aspects of Squarespace with the data handling prowess of PostgreSQL. This synergy allows for:
- Enhanced user experiences by presenting personalized content.
- Efficient data management and reporting.
- Real-time updates to website content directly from the database.
In conclusion, while PostgreSQL and Squarespace serve different purposes in the web development landscape, their integration can open up new possibilities. By using a no-code platform like Latenode, users can harness the strengths of both tools, creating a multifunctional website that meets diverse business needs.
Most Powerful Ways To Connect PostgreSQL and Squarespace?
Connecting PostgreSQL and Squarespace can unlock powerful opportunities for data management and dynamic website functionality. Here are three of the most effective methods to achieve this integration:
- Using Integration Platforms: Utilizing a no-code integration platform such as Latenode allows you to seamlessly connect PostgreSQL with Squarespace. This method enables you to automate data flows without any coding knowledge. You can easily set up triggers and actions that respond to changes in your PostgreSQL database, facilitating real-time data updates on your Squarespace site.
- Webhooks with Custom Scripts: Squarespace supports the use of webhooks, which can be extended with custom scripts. By setting up webhook endpoints in your PostgreSQL server, you can send data back and forth between the two platforms. This approach is ideal for users comfortable with scripting, as it provides increased flexibility and control over how data is exchanged.
- API Integration: Both PostgreSQL and Squarespace offer API capabilities. Using the Squarespace API, you can create a custom back-end application that interfaces with your PostgreSQL database. This method allows for extensive customization of your data integration, enabling you to manipulate data in intricate ways, such as filtering and transforming data before pushing it to your Squarespace site.
By leveraging these approaches, you can effectively connect PostgreSQL with Squarespace, enhancing the functionality and interactivity of your web presence.
How Does PostgreSQL work?
PostgreSQL is a powerful open-source relational database management system that excels in handling complex queries and large datasets. Its ability to integrate with various platforms makes it a preferred choice for developers and businesses looking to streamline their applications. When discussing how PostgreSQL works with integrations, it is essential to understand its compatibility with APIs, ETL tools, and low-code/no-code platforms.
One notable aspect of PostgreSQL integration is its robust support for standard database protocols. This allows developers to connect the database with various application frameworks seamlessly. By using connectors and libraries, such as the psycopg2 for Python or JDBC for Java, developers can build applications that interact directly with the PostgreSQL database. This interoperability enhances functionality and opens up a world of opportunities for integrating external services.
- APIs: PostgreSQL can be accessed via RESTful APIs, allowing for remote operations and interactions with other software solutions.
- ETL Tools: Tools like Apache Nifi or Talend can facilitate data transfer and transformation between PostgreSQL and other databases, making it easier to manage data flow.
- Low-Code/No-Code Platforms: Platforms such as Latenode enable users to create applications that leverage PostgreSQL without writing extensive code. These tools simplify the creation of workflows that include data retrieval, updates, and even complex business logic.
Furthermore, PostgreSQL supports a variety of formats for data import and export, including JSON, XML, and CSV, which makes it easy to integrate with different systems. The database also features extensive documentation and a community-driven approach, making it accessible for integration projects of all sizes. With its versatility and robustness, PostgreSQL serves as a reliable backbone for applications requiring complex data interactions and integrations.
How Does Squarespace work?
Squarespace offers robust integration capabilities that allow users to connect their websites with various third-party applications and services. These integrations enhance the functionality of your website without requiring any coding knowledge. By utilizing these connections, users can streamline operations, manage content, and analyze data more effectively.
One of the key ways Squarespace makes integrations work is through its built-in tools and APIs, which facilitate smooth connections to various platforms. Users can link Squarespace with services like email marketing software, social media platforms, and eCommerce solutions. For instance, integrating with an email marketing tool allows you to grow your subscriber list directly from your website, making it easier to reach your audience.
Additionally, platforms like Latenode provide no-code solutions to enhance your Squarespace experience further. By using Latenode, you can create custom workflows that automate tasks between your Squarespace site and other applications. This means you can easily sync data, manage inventory, or trigger events based on user actions without writing a single line of code.
To make the most of Squarespace integrations, you can follow these steps:
- Identify the tools you want to integrate with.
- Navigate to the integrations page within Squarespace settings.
- Follow the prompts to connect your desired applications.
- Test the integration to ensure everything is functioning correctly.
With these integrations, Squarespace users can create a versatile and efficient online presence tailored to their specific needs.
FAQ PostgreSQL and Squarespace
How can I connect my PostgreSQL database to Squarespace using Latenode?
To connect your PostgreSQL database to Squarespace via Latenode, follow these steps:
- Sign in to your Latenode account.
- Create a new integration and select PostgreSQL as your data source.
- Input your PostgreSQL database credentials, including the hostname, port, database name, username, and password.
- In the same integration, choose Squarespace as your destination.
- Map the fields from PostgreSQL to the corresponding fields in Squarespace.
- Save and activate the integration.
What types of data can I sync between PostgreSQL and Squarespace?
You can sync various types of data, including:
- Products and inventory items
- Blog posts and articles
- Customer information and orders
- Custom form submissions
- Any other structured data that matches Squarespace's content types
Can I automate data updates between PostgreSQL and Squarespace?
Yes, data updates can be automated. You can set triggers or scheduled tasks within Latenode to perform data sync at specified intervals or based on events, ensuring that your Squarespace site reflects the latest information from your PostgreSQL database without manual intervention.
What should I do if I encounter connection issues?
If you encounter connection issues between PostgreSQL and Squarespace:
- Check your database credentials for accuracy.
- Ensure that your PostgreSQL database is accessible from the internet (if necessary, configure IP whitelisting).
- Verify that your database server is up and running.
- Review the connection settings in Latenode for any potential misconfigurations.
- Consult Latenode's support documentation or contact their support team for further assistance.
Is there a limit on the amount of data I can sync?
While there is no strict limit on the amount of data you can sync, performance may vary based on the size of the dataset and frequency of synchronization. It's recommended to test with smaller datasets initially and monitor performance. If you reach performance constraints, consider optimizing your queries or periodic syncing to manage load effectively.